Mold Tek Technologies Ltd Share Price — Live NSE/BSE Price, Fundamentals & Analysis
Mold Tek Technologies Ltd share price today is ₹118.40, up +0.38% on NSE/BSE as of 22 June 2026. Mold Tek Technologies Ltd (MOLDTECH) is a Small-cap company in the Civil Construction sector with a market capitalisation of ₹480.51 (Cr). The 52-week high for MOLDTECH share price is ₹221.00 and the 52-week low is ₹101.10. At a P/E ratio of 165.69x, MOLDTECH is currently trading above its industry average P/E of 18.93x. The company has a Return on Equity (ROE) of 8.61% and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.04.

About MOLDTECH (Mold Tek Technologies Ltd)
Mold-Tek Technologies Ltd is a prominent engineering solutions provider specializing in the dynamic realm of civil construction. With a global footprint, the company delivers compr...ehensive design and detailing services vital for modern infrastructure development. Their core competency lies in offering precise structural steel detailing, connection design, and delegated design solutions that guarantee structural integrity and efficient construction workflows. Beyond structural steel, Mold-Tek Technologies also provides invaluable precast detailing services, ensuring the seamless integration of pre-fabricated elements within larger building projects. A dedication to innovation positions Mold-Tek Technologies at the forefront of the industry, helping clients achieve project goals with optimized designs. The company's service portfolio further encompasses a broad range of construction-related solutions. Mold-Tek Technologies provides meticulous miscellaneous steel detailing crucial for completing projects accurately and efficiently. Their expertise extends to structural steel estimating, which ensures projects are budgeted effectively. Finally, Mold-Tek Technologies offers expert pre-engineered steel building design services, providing clients with cost-effective and sustainable building solutions.
